Jobs for Funeral Direction/Service Grads in Kansas
There are 480 people in the state and 34,140 people in the nation working in funeral direction/service jobs.

Wages for Funeral Direction/Service Jobs in Kansas
A typical salary for a funeral direction/service grad in the state is $57,990, compared to a typical salary of $57,620 nationwide.
